How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bolton Hill?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Bolton Hill Studio Apartments | $1,668 | $983 | $2,330 |
| Bolton Hill 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,945 | $900 | $2,907 |
| Bolton Hill 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,180 | $1,199 | $3,359 |
| Bolton Hill 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,998 | $1,695 | $2,300 |
| Bolton Hill 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,343 | $1,900 | $3,130 |

Cheapest Available Bolton Hill Studio Apartments
Currently the lowest priced Studio apartment unit Bolton Hill of Baltimore, MD is the Studio Model starting from $983 at Linden Park Apartments (Seniors 62+). The average price for all Studio apartments in Bolton Hill is currently $1,668.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available Studio options in the area: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
|---|---|---|
| Linden Park Apartments (Seniors 62+) | Studio | $983 |
| 1214 Eutaw Pl | Studio | $1,195 |
| The Jordan Apartments | Studio | $1,200 |
| ReNew Mt. Vernon | Fayette | $1,389 |
| The Fitzgerald | The Daisy | $1,721 |
